Definitions:

Genetic-Environment Correlations

The interaction between an individual's genetic makeup and their surrounding environment, influencing traits and behaviors.

Passive Correlation

A concept in behavioral genetics where an individual's traits result indirectly from the environment provided by their biological parents.

Active Correlation

A concept in genetics suggesting that an individual’s genes encourage them to seek out environments that complement their inherited traits.

Niche-Picking

Choosing environmental conditions that foster one’s genetically transmitted abilities and interests.
